Social Media Decoded

Michelle Thames

Social Media Decoded is your go-to podcast for marketing, visibility, and monetization strategies to grow your business online. Hosted by marketing expert Michelle Thames, this show breaks down social media, content marketing, and business growth into actionable steps for entrepreneurs, creators, and brands.     The Visibility Gap: Why People See You But Don’t Buy

    You’re posting. You’re showing up. People are watching. But they’re not buying. So what’s missing? In this episode of Social Media Decoded, Michelle Thames breaks down what she calls the visibility gap—the space between being seen online and actually converting that visibility into clients. She shares why engagement doesn’t equal revenue, the real reasons your audience isn’t taking action, and how to fix the disconnect between your content and your offers. If you’ve been feeling stuck, inconsistent, or unsure why your content isn’t turning into income, this episode will help you identify exactly what’s missing and what to do next. What You’ll Learn in This Episode • Why visibility alone doesn’t lead to sales • The difference between engagement and conversion • The real reasons people aren’t buying from you • How unclear offers and weak messaging impact your results • Why most entrepreneurs don’t have a conversion system • How to build a pathway from content to clients Visibility Breakdown Michelle explains the gap between visibility and revenue: Content → Attention → (Gap) → Conversion → Client Most entrepreneurs are missing the structure needed to move people from attention to action. ️ Unpopular Truth Visibility without a system is just noise.     How Speaking Opportunities Actually Turn Into Clients

    Speaking is one of the fastest ways to build visibility in your business—but visibility alone doesn’t pay you. In this episode of Social Media Decoded, Michelle Thames shares what most people don’t understand about speaking opportunities and why getting on stage is only the beginning. She walks through what actually happens after the stage, why most speakers don’t convert, and how to build a system that turns visibility into real opportunities and paying clients. If you’ve been focused on getting booked but not seeing results, this episode will show you exactly what’s missing. What You’ll Learn in This Episode • Why speaking alone doesn’t lead to clients • What happens after you get off stage (and why it matters) • How to create a clear next step for your audience • The importance of follow-up and continuing the conversation • How to build a system that converts visibility into revenue • Why messaging and positioning impact conversion Visibility Breakdown Michelle shares her framework for converting speaking opportunities: Stage → Connection → Follow-Up → Ecosystem → Client Speaking creates visibility, but your system is what drives conversion. Unpopular Truth The stage gets you seen. The system gets you paid.
